About This Program
The Wooden Boatbuilding Technology/Technician program at Northwest School of Wooden Boat Building in Port Hadlock, WA is a two- to four-year certificate at this private nonprofit institution. It falls within the precision production trades field (CIP 48.0704) and provides students with specialized training in the design, construction, and repair of wooden boats using traditional and contemporary methods.
Northwest School of Wooden Boat Building also offers a Marine Engineering Technology/Technician certificate, giving students the opportunity to complement wooden boatbuilding skills with training in marine systems and engineering. Students in the wooden boatbuilding program can expect hands-on instruction in lofting, joinery, planking, fastenings, finishing, and the historical and technical knowledge underlying traditional wooden vessel construction.
